fromThe New Yorker
2 months ago

Five Lessons from MAGA

The Drug Abuse Resistance Education program ( DARE) and Mothers Against Drunk Driving ( MADD) both got their starts in the nineteen-eighties. MADD emerged as one of the greatest examples of grassroots political activism in modern America, but DARE has been judged mostly a failure. Why did one flourish while the other proved to be merely a passing fad? Duhigg argues that the answer is in the difference between "mobilizing" and "organizing."

fromwww.dw.com
2 months ago

Why Trump and his Republicans can't take over US elections

"It has been baked in that the states are largely in charge of the election process, and that the federal government can set or override rules for that process if they wish, but it's very specific that that has to be done through Congress and not through lone executive action," said Justin Levitt, a constitutional and law of democracy scholar at Loyola Law School who was a non-partisan policy adviser for Democracy and Voting Rights during the Biden White House.
